Output 3af5405c0653d660bfe5baf948c17bd5d8dced609b4dde012e4458fd49ad7cfc:3

value
9910445
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9670cc8ea781225b8cfa96c266bc0879de5a945620ca63d0d75945bbe96366e9
address
tb1pjecver48sy39hr86jmpxd0qg080949zkyr9x85xht9zmh6trvm5sxsy8te
transaction
3af5405c0653d660bfe5baf948c17bd5d8dced609b4dde012e4458fd49ad7cfc
confirmations
76522
spent
true